Experts Figured Out How Much Training You Have to have to ‘Offset’ a Working day of Sitting

We know that investing hour soon after hour sitting down down just isn’t excellent for us, but just how substantially exercise is required to counteract the destructive overall health effect of a day at a desk? A 2020 research implies about 30-40 minutes for every day of setting up up a sweat should really do it.

 

Up to 40 minutes of “reasonable to vigorous depth bodily exercise” each individual day is about the ideal total to balance out 10 hrs of sitting down even now, the study claims – whilst any sum of exercising or even just standing up will help to some extent.

That’s dependent on a meta-investigation throughout 9 previous research, involving a total of 44,370 people today in 4 different nations around the world who were being donning some variety of fitness tracker.

The investigation identified the threat of loss of life amid all those with a additional sedentary way of life went up as time expended engaging in reasonable-to-vigorous intensity bodily action went down.

“In lively people undertaking about 30-40 minutes of moderate to vigorous depth actual physical activity, the association amongst high sedentary time and chance of death is not drastically various from people with lower amounts of sedentary time,” the scientists wrote in the British Journal of Athletics Medicine (BJSM) in 2020.

In other words, placing in some fairly intense functions – cycling, brisk strolling, gardening – can lessen your hazard of an previously dying proper back again down to what it would be if you weren’t performing all that sitting all over, to the extent that this connection can be observed in the amassed info of several countless numbers of individuals.

 

Though meta-analyses like this just one always need some elaborate dot-becoming a member of across individual studies with diverse volunteers, timescales, and disorders, the benefit of this particular piece of investigation is that it relied on comparatively goal info from wearables – not details self-documented by the participants.

The examine was printed along with the launch of the World Wellbeing Firm 2020 Worldwide Tips on Bodily Activity and Sedentary Habits, put collectively by 40 scientists across six continents. In actuality, in November 2020 BJSM place out a particular edition to carry both equally the new review and the new suggestions.

“These rules are incredibly well timed, provided that we are in the middle of a world pandemic, which has confined persons indoors for extended durations and inspired an enhance in sedentary actions,” stated physical action and inhabitants wellness researcher Emmanuel Stamatakis from the College of Sydney in Australia.

“Men and women can still safeguard their wellbeing and offset the harmful outcomes of physical inactivity,” claims Stamatakis, who was not included in the meta-analysis but is the co-editor of the BJSM. “As these tips emphasize, all physical action counts and any sum of it is better than none.”

 

The investigate centered on conditioning trackers is broadly in line with the new WHO recommendations, which advise 150-300 mins of moderate depth or 75-150 mins of vigorous-depth physical activity each week to counter sedentary behavior.

Going for walks up the stairs alternatively of taking the lift, enjoying with kids and animals, getting portion in yoga or dancing, accomplishing home chores, walking, and biking are all place ahead as strategies in which people can be extra lively – and if you can not control the 30-40 minutes suitable away, the scientists say, get started off modest.

Creating tips throughout all ages and overall body styles is tricky, even though the 40 minute time frame for activity suits in with previous investigation. As more information are revealed, we should really find out much more about how to remain healthy even if we have to invest extended durations of time at a desk.

“While the new guidelines mirror the best available science, there are nevertheless some gaps in our expertise,” claimed Stamatakis.

“We are however not crystal clear, for illustration, wherever particularly the bar for ‘too significantly sitting’ is. But this is a quick-paced field of study, and we will ideally have answers in a number of years’ time.”

The analysis was printed right here, and the WHO tips below, in the British Journal of Sporting activities Medicine.
